Look at your thoughts
One of the first step to begin on personal development. Everything you do in life, achievements, failures are shaped by your thoughts and the thoughts in your mind.
Goes by this sequence –
Thoughts-Feelings-Actions-Results
When you change your thoughts, the entire process changes.

Identify your thoughts
Look at the above sequence and identify your current thoughts.
Ask yourself-
– Is this thought positive/negative?
– If negative, what can I think instead?
– How does that change in thought makes me feel?

Natural Supplements for Anxiety

Depending on tranquillisers for lowering anxiety is not always a very helpful way of managing your anxiety. It reduces coagulation process which is not very healthy from a long term point of view.

As we all know that anxiety at some point or other makes us feel as if we are in a whirlpool of irreconcilability and unpredictability. The WHO report suggests that anxiety and depression are the most common among other mental disorders. And, this definitely raises a concern to work on health more efficiently.

One good news is that anxiety can be well managed, if taken care of. Usually the mainstream treatments for anxiety related disorders are anti-anxiety drugs and psychotherapies.

Along with the existing ways of managing anxiety, natural supplements can help in relieving symptoms of anxiety. Given below are some of these natural supplements which can be consumed on a regular basis.

Vitamins A, B, C and D
 Vitamins are organic molecules that are essential micro nutrients that an organism needs in small quantities for the proper functioning of metabolism.
Vitamin A helps the nervous system and muscles relax. It minimizes stress and ultimately calming your anxiety. Some signs of vitamin A deficiency are- acne breakouts, longer wound healing time or infertility. Some vitamin A supplements are – carrots, eggs, skimmed milk, etc.
Vitamin B helps in combating stress. It is used to create and repair neurotransmitters that regulate mood and behavior. Low levels may cause mental decline. Some vitamin B supplements are- whole grains, seeds and nuts, legumes
Vitamin C deficiency can make you often feel fatigued or depressed. Eat plenty of fruits and vegetables rich in vitamin C, such as oranges and red peppers.
Vitamin D plays a vital role in regulating mood. It absorbs calcium and phosphorus and somewhat plays a role in building immunity. Eating foods rich in Vitamin D such as salmon, shrimp, egg yolk, mushroom, soy milk and lastly absorbing some sun on a regular basis can help you feel better.

Chamomile
Chamomile is a herb, widely used in form of tea due to its refreshing abilities. A study from Nottingham Medical School found, consuming chamomile supplements helps smooth muscle fibers and relax blood vessels significantly.

Lemon Balm
Lemon balm is a part of the mint family. It is popular for its calming and relaxing effects. It may help you with calming down and improving your mood. It is safe to use and has no reported side effects.

All these supplements can help you with anxiety in a natural way. You may consult with a general physician before beginning one for yourself.

Cultivating Punctuality

Before beginning to work on punctuality, it is essential that you understand what is making you late. Watch yourself and your routine carefully to identify what really is making you late. DeLonzor author of Never Be Late Again says – many late people — including herself — are likely to have an aversion to leaving the house. To combat this she uses a mantra of sorts: “When I catch myself doing this, I’ll snap or clap and say ‘This can wait.”
